Where does the Crested Oropendola live?

Psarocolius decumanus has 266,482 records in 19 countries and territories, from 1800 to 2026. Most records come from Colombia.

When it is recorded

JFMAMJJASOND

Peak month: October. Records cluster in the months an animal is present and being looked for, so a summer peak can reflect observer effort as much as the animal.
